Novartis India, a small-cap pharmaceutical company, has seen a slight decline in stock price and a year-over-year decrease, underperforming compared to the Sensex. Technical indicators present a mixed outlook, with some signs of bullish momentum, while longer-term returns remain below the broader market's performance.
Novartis India, a small-cap player in the Pharmaceuticals and Biotechnology sector, has recently undergone an evaluation revision reflecting its current market dynamics. The stock is currently priced at 1003.10, slightly down from the previous close of 1012.10. Over the past year, Novartis India has experienced a decline of 3.38%, contrasting with a 7.50% gain in the Sensex, indicating a challenging performance relative to the broader market.

In terms of technical indicators, the weekly MACD shows bullish momentum, while the monthly outlook remains mildly bearish. The Bollinger Bands suggest a mildly bullish trend on both weekly and monthly scales, indicating some potential for price stability. However, moving averages present a mildly bearish stance on a daily basis, reflecting short-term pressures.

The company's performance over various time frames reveals a mixed picture. While it has achieved a notable 72.92% return over three years, its five-year return of 69.69% lags behind the Sensex's impressive 142.80% increase. This evaluation adjustment highlights the need for Novartis India to navigate its market position carefully as it seeks to align more closely with broader market trends.
